Do you put the title of your essay in quotation marks?

If you are writing something else and referring to an essay you have written, you would put the title of that essay in quotation marks, but the title at the top of your essay (like the title of any document) should not have quotation marks.


What is the purpose of expository essay?

The purpose of an expository essay is to explain a topic. The essay can be an explanation about a demonstration, lecture, to clarify a process or to instruct a reader on how to do something.


What type of essay informs or explains?

An expository essay is used to explain or inform. An argumentative essay attempts to persuade the reader to agree with the author.


What is typically included in the introductory section of an expository essay?

The introduction of an essay consists of the thesis of your essay (otherwise known as a statement that says what the essay will be about), some background on whatever the topic you are writing on is, and if you are analyzing a book or story the author and title of the book.
